From the Fed: Industrial Production and Capacity Utilization Industrial production rose 0.4 percent in March but declined at an annual rate of 1.8 percent in the first quarter. Manufacturing output increased 0.5 percent in March, boosted in part by a gain of 3.1 percent in motor vehicles and parts; factory output excluding motor vehicles and parts moved up 0.3 percent.

I was perusing the BLS data following the inflation release last week and one number sticks out like Victor Wembanyana standing next to a group of kindergartners. Auto insurance was up 22% over the previous 12 months versus an overall inflation rate of 3.5%. Look at the change in auto insurance rates these past few years: It’s like a meme stock.

The title for this post is inspired by the following post on Threads. Fixed income, meaning intermediate and longer term duration, is having a rough 2024 after a meh 2023 and terrible 2022. For most of those ETFs you can add 100-125 basis points back in for dividends. For TLTW which is TLT with a covered call overlay you can add back about 300 basis points.
